Design and Development of Apparatus for Evaluating Galling Resistance Test

In the present study, a custom made galling test setup has been developed and tested for use. The preliminary result obtained with mild steel specimens is presented. The present test configuration consists of two coaxially aligned hollow cylindrical specimen loaded along the longitudinal axis. The specimen holder is provided with an internal taper of 3° and specimen with an external taper of 3°, to ensure firm grip between the holder and the specimens. The test configuration adheres to American Society for Testing and Materials (ASTM) G196 standards, in which the resulting contacting surface is in the shape of annulus and there is uniform distribution of pressure. It was found that the results obtained through this setup are satisfactory and reproducible. The purpose of the present work is to design, develop and qualify a fixture for conducting galling tests.
